Output 59eb95a53d5d18e1d924d5e7343419a4d25222ed389d0698605e6310d71dc09b:1

value
200000000
script pubkey
OP_0 OP_PUSHBYTES_20 72e11d62e08a6e1fdd36fd61188dedbb28c97b14
address
bc1qwts36chq3fhplhfkl4s33r0dhv5vj7c5pe7w7u
transaction
59eb95a53d5d18e1d924d5e7343419a4d25222ed389d0698605e6310d71dc09b
confirmations
178376
spent
true